The rates of a locksmith differ based on the kind of work is required and how long it will take. Some locksmiths will charge an hourly fee, while others might offer a flat fee for a specific job. For emergency calls for instance, when you are locked out of your house or car, they will charge you more. You can look up their prices on their website or by calling them. Some companies will provide an estimate of the work that they will perform. Some companies offer a guarantee for their services. This is an important factor to think about when selecting the locksmith.

Professional locksmiths are equipped with various tools for specialization in addition to the standard tools. They usually employ a tension device and shim in order to pick a lock. A shim is a small metal piece that's inserted into the lock to create more leverage and make it easier for them to choose the pins and tumblers. They also use magnets to catch tiny pieces of metal that may fall off the lock while they're working on it.
